Exeter suffered their first Sky Bet League Two defeat of the season as Troy Brown’s own goal and Devon Kelly-Evans’ first Football League goal secured Coventry a 2-0 win.Defender Brown turned a low cross from Jodi Jones past goalkeeper Christy Pym in the 58th minute before Kelly-Evans fired in a last-gasp second from a Jones pass.Notts County moved to the top of the table with a convincing 4-1 win against 10-man Lincoln.90' – GOAL! Luton were reduced to 10 men with 13 minutes remaining when Pelly Ruddock was sent off for a late challenge on Andy Kellett but Nathan Jones’ side held on.Mansfield came from behind to beat Cambridge 2-1, with a Jacob Mellis penalty and 87th-minute Danny Rose strike cancelling out Leon Legge’s opener.Danny Grainger scored twice as Carlisle romped to a 5-0 win at Crewe, with Alex defender Michael Raynes giving away a penalty and scoring an own goal against his former club. Craig Mackail-Smith grabbed the winner for Wycombe in a 2-1 success at Colchester and Port Vale held on for 1-1 draw at Yeovil, despite Jamie Gibbons’ dismissal with eight minutes remaining.
